Diamond grinding is typically used to level uneven pavement and to roughen surfaces for skid resistance. It has low dust levels, removes epoxies and urethanes but is slower than other methods. Some diamond grinders can also leave swirl marks in the slab if you're overly aggressive.
Some of the advantages of a diamond ground pavements include:
|
• Provides a smooth surface that is often as good or better than a new pavement
•
Enhances surface texture and friction
and there is no evidence of deleterious effects
• These improvements reduce the potential for small-vehicle hydroplaning
• Does not significantly affect fatigue life of a pavement
•
Does not affect material durability unless the coarse aggregate is a soft stone subject to polishing
• May be applied only where is needed, however, spot grinding is generally not usually recommended
•
Restoring smoothness to faulted or curled concrete highways
Improve skid resistance
•
Level doorway entrances
•
Smooth driveway approaches

Scratch Coat Grinding / Sanding |
This method is achieved by attaching various sized grit sanding pads to the concrete floor grinder. It prepares, cleans and abrades existing coatings for recoat. This process removes thin layer coatings and provides texture for two coatings to bond together. This method is slow and intensive. This technique works for coatings that were recently applied and that need to be touched up with an additional coating. This type of sanding is often refered to as "Scratch and recoat".
